That the same Fees be paid in case The Speaker shall refer to the Taxing Officer any Bill of Costs, under the authority of an Act of the sixth year of his late Majesty King George the Fourth, "To establish a Taxation of Costs on Private Bills in the House of Commons."

That every Bill for the particular interest or benefit of any person or persons, whether the same be brought in upon Petition, or Motion, or Report from a Committee, or brought from the Lords, hath been and ought to be deemed a Private Bill within the meaning of the Table of Fees.

[merged small][merged small][merged small][ocr errors][merged small][merged small][merged small][merged small][merged small][merged small]

The preceding fees shall be charged, paid, and received at such times, in such manner, and under such regulations as The Speaker shall from time to time direct.

Mercurii, 27° die Julii, 1864.

Ordered, That the said Table of Fees be a Standing Order of this House.

Chairman of Committee of Ways and Means:

To confer with the Chairman of Committees of the House of Lords, or with his Counsel, in order to determine in which House the respective Bills should. be first considered, 79.

With the assistance of the Counsel to Mr. Speaker, to examine all Bills, whether opposed or unopposed, and copies of such Bills to be laid by the agent before them not later than the day after the Examiner shall have indorsed the petition, 80.

To report on Bills relating to government contracts, 81.

Copies of Bill as proposed to be submitted to the committee on any Bill, to be laid before him and the Counsel to Mr. Speaker two days before the meeting of the committee, 82.

To report special circumstances relative to any Bill, or opinion that an unopposed should be treated as an opposed Bill, 83. Copy of Bill as amended in committee to be laid before him and the Counsel to Mr. Speaker three days before the consideration thereof, 84.

Clauses or amendments offered on consideration of any Bill ordered to lie upon the Table, or verbal amendments on third reading, to be submitted to him and the Counsel to Mr. Speaker, and the Chairman to report whether the same should be entertained without being referred to Standing Orders Committee, 85, 216.

Copy of amendments made in the Lords to a Bill, and of proposed amendments thereto, to be laid before him and

Chairman of Committee of Ways and Meanscontinued.

the Counsel to Mr. Speaker on the day previous to the consideration of the same by the House, 86.

With the Deputy Chairman and seven other members of the House to be Referees on Private Bills, 87.

To make rules of practice and procedure of the Referees, 88.

To be ex-officio Chairman of Committees on unopposed Bills, 109.

On his report that any unopposed Bill ought to be treated as opposed it is to be again referred to the Committee of Selection, or General Committee on Railway and Canal Bills, who are so to treat it, 209.

On or before consideration of report of Bill, to report whether the Bill contains the provisions required by the standing orders, 215.

With Chairman of Committees of House of Lords to determine practice and procedure under the Private Legislation Procedure (Scotland) Act, 251.

Reports on draft provisional orders to the Secretary for Scotland, signed by him, to be laid before the House, 252.
